Lawrence McGinty brought local residents and an expert together, to discuss the controversial practice. Protesters at a camp near a potential fracking site in Balcombe today started packing up and returning home. But the issue - which is facing many communities across the UK - won't be going away. People in Lancashire were the first to feel the negative effects of fracking when earth tremors hit the coast in 2011.
